Transaction e003f7109eaf5155b92612e2abd4e83fddd823be92633791515319ee58dcf26e
1 Input
1 Output
-
e003f7109eaf5155b92612e2abd4e83fddd823be92633791515319ee58dcf26e:0
- value
- 988163
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8e0108d59a336dd752b98c6649f3da2979ad495
- address
- bc1qlrsppr2e5vmd6aftnrrxf8ea52te44y4w2nf02